This guided meditation invites you to connect with the quiet, unseen growth that happens beneath the surface—much like seeds resting in the earth before they sprout. Through gentle breath awareness and visualization, you will cultivate grounding, nourishment, and patience, allowing space for future growth. Whether you’re in a season of transition or simply seeking stillness, this practice will help you embrace the present while preparing for what’s to come. Settle into a comfortable position, let go of tension, and allow yourself to be supported by the earth beneath you.

Transcript

Hello and welcome to this guided meditation,

Planting seeds of growth.

Take a moment to find a comfortable place to lie down,

Whether on a yoga mat,

A soft rug,

Or even your bed.

Let your arms rest gently by your sides,

Palms facing up or down,

Whatever feels most natural.

Allow your legs to relax,

Your feet falling slightly open,

And close your eyes.

Take a deep breath in through your nose and exhale slowly through your mouth.

Let go of the day so far,

Releasing any tension or expectation.

And as you settle in,

Allow yourself to arrive fully in this moment.

Let go of the weight of the day and feel your body soften into the support of the earth beneath you.

This meditation is about quiet growth,

The kind that happens beneath the surface before anything is seen.

Like seeds resting in the earth during winter,

We also have times of stillness where important transformation takes place.

Today we honor this phase of nourishment,

Grounding,

And trust.

Now feel the ground beneath you,

Steady and unwavering.

Imagine your body sinking into this support,

As if you are becoming one with it.

Bring your awareness to your breath.

Inhale deeply,

As if drawing in warmth from deep within the soil.

And exhale slowly,

Releasing tension,

Making space for rest and renewal.

Relax your jaw,

Your tongue,

Your forehead,

Your shoulders,

Your hands,

Your hips,

And your feet.

Allow yourself to soften,

Knowing that rest is part of growth.

Now imagine yourself in a quiet winter landscape.

The air is crisp,

The earth cool and still.

And beneath the surface,

Something is happening.

Deep within you,

There is a seed,

Holding your intentions,

Your future growth.

This seed does not need to rush.

It is safe where it is,

Gathering strength,

Taking in the quiet nourishment of the season.

With every inhale,

Feel this seed absorbing what it needs.

Moisture,

Warmth,

Stillness.

With each exhale,

Release anything unnecessary.

Old habits,

Tension,

Impatience.

Tiny roots slowly begin to extend downward,

Reaching for stability.

This is where growth begins.

Below the surface,

Unseen but strong.

Trust in this process.

Growth does not always look like movement.

But even in stillness,

Transformation is happening.

Now bring your attention to the center of your body.

The space just below your belly button.

Your foundation.

Imagine warmth gathering there,

Like the deep reserves of energy in the earth.

Sustaining life through winter.

Breathe in this quiet strength.

And breathe out anything that makes you feel unsteady.

You don't need to push or force growth.

Just as the earth knows when to soften and when to open.

Your own process will unfold in its time.

For now,

You are simply gathering what you need.

Slowly bring your awareness back to the present moment.

Feel the weight of your body on the ground.

The steadiness beneath you.

Wiggle your fingers and your toes,

Gently waking up your body.

Take a final deep breath.

Drawing in patience and trust.

Exhale,

Grounding yourself in this quiet phase of growth.

And when you're ready,

Roll onto your right side,

Resting there for a moment.

Slowly come up to a seated position and carry this sense of nourishment and steadiness with you.
